Lexar Media Files Patent Infringement Complaint Against SanDisk Corporation FREMONT, Calif., Sept. 7 /PRNewswire/ -- Lexar Media, Inc. (Nasdaq: LEXR - news) today announced that it has filed a patent infringement lawsuit against SanDisk Corporation (Nasdaq: SNDK - news) alleging that SanDisk infringes one of Lexar's key patents. The patent infringement complaint was filed in United States District Court, District of Delaware. Lexar's President John Reimer stated, ``Lexar has core technology on flash products that we have to protect. We tried to resolve our disputes with SanDisk outside of Court, but as those efforts have failed, we are forced to defend our intellectual property. We are currently looking closely at a number of other SanDisk products as well.'' Lexar Media is seeking preliminary and permanent injunctive relief and damages for its patent infringement claim. About Lexar Media Lexar Media designs, develops and markets a complete line of removable and reusable digital film in the four most popular industry formats: CompactFlash, Memory Stick, SmartMedia and PC Cards. The Company also offers easy-to-use connectivity products to transfer photographic images to the computer. Lexar's business unit, PrintRoom.com(TM), provides online photo-finishing services. Lexar Media is headquartered in Fremont, California and has offices in the England and Japan.
